Thalamēgus
(
θαλάμηγος). A sort of barge used by the kings and princes
of Egypt for their trips on the Nile. Cleopatra 's famous barge was a thalamegus
(
Iul. 52). The craft was fitted up with much luxury, and was named from the
fact that it had cabins (
thalami) for a numerous company. The pure Latin
name is
navis cubiculata (
De Ben. vii. 70).
